// holds an instance of XMLHttpRequest
var xmlHttp_deletecart = createXmlHttpRequestObject();
// creates an XMLHttpRequest instance
function createXmlHttpRequestObject()
{
// will store the reference to the XMLHttpRequest object
var xmlHttp_deletecart;
// this should work for all browsers except IE6 and older
try
{
// try to create xmlHttp_deletecartRequest object
xmlHttp_deletecart = new XMLHttpRequest();
}
catch(e)
{
// assume IE6 or older
try
{
xmlHttp_deletecart = new ActiveXObject("Microsoft.XMLHttp");
}
catch(e) { }
}
// return the created object or display an error message
if (!xmlHttp_deletecart)
alert("Error creating the XMLHttpRequest object.");
else
return xmlHttp_deletecart;
}
	// called to read a file from the server
	
	 
	
	function deletecart(id)
	{
 		
		if(confirm("Are you sure?"))
		{
		 
		 var url = "deletecart.php?id="+id;
		 
		if (xmlHttp_deletecart)
		{
		// try to connect to the server
			try
			{
			
			xmlHttp_deletecart.open("POST", url, true);
			xmlHttp_deletecart.onreadystatechange = handleRequestStateChange_deletecart;
			xmlHttp_deletecart.send(null);
			}
			// display the error in case of failure
			catch (e)
			{
			alert("Can't connect to server:\n" + e.toString());
			}
		}
		
		}
	
	}
	
	
	
	
	
	
	// function that handles the HTTP response
	function handleRequestStateChange_deletecart()
	{
	// obtain a reference to the <div> element on the page
	
	// display the status of the request
	if (xmlHttp_deletecart.readyState == 1)
	{
		
		
		//document.getElementById("default_tab").style.display="block";

	}/*
	else if (xmlHttp_deletecart.readyState == 2)
	{
	myDiv.innerHTML += "Request status: 2 (loaded) <br/>";
	}
	else if (xmlHttp_deletecart.readyState == 3)
	{
	myDiv.innerHTML += "Request status: 3 (interactive) <br/>";
	}
	// when readyState is 4, we also read the server response
	*/
	else if (xmlHttp_deletecart.readyState == 4)
	{
		// continue only if HTTP status is "OK"
 
		if (xmlHttp_deletecart.status == 200)
		{
				
			try
			{
			
				response = xmlHttp_deletecart.responseText;
				 
		 		document.getElementById("cart").innerHTML = response;
			 	showcart();
			
			}
			catch(e)
			{
			// display error message
				alert("Error reading the response: " + e.toString());
			}
		}
		else
		{
			// display status message
		alert("There was a problem retrieving the data:\n" +
		xmlHttp_deletecart.statusText);
		}
		
	}
}


